引言
在数字化转型的浪潮中,数据中台、数字孪生和数字可视化技术逐渐成为企业提升竞争力的重要工具。数栈灵瞳作为一款专注于数据处理、分析和可视化的工具,为企业提供了高效的数据管理和可视化解决方案。本文将深入探讨数栈灵瞳的技术实现与优化方法,帮助企业更好地理解和应用这一技术。
数栈灵瞳技术概述
数栈灵瞳是一款基于大数据和人工智能技术的可视化平台,旨在帮助企业从海量数据中提取有价值的信息,并通过直观的可视化方式呈现。其核心技术包括数据采集、数据处理、数据建模、数据可视化和交互优化。
1. 数据采集与处理
数栈灵瞳支持多种数据源的接入,包括数据库、API、文件和实时流数据。数据采集过程采用分布式架构,确保高效处理大规模数据。数据处理阶段包括数据清洗、转换和标准化,以确保数据质量。
数据采集流程:
- 实时数据采集: 使用高效的数据抽取工具,支持多种协议(如HTTP、TCP、UDP)。
- 离线数据处理: 通过批量处理工具(如Spark、Hadoop)完成历史数据的清洗和转换。
- 数据存储: 数据存储在分布式文件系统(如HDFS)或数据库中,确保数据的可靠性和可扩展性。
2. 数据建模与分析
数栈灵瞳利用机器学习和深度学习算法对数据进行建模和分析,帮助企业发现数据中的隐藏规律。常见的建模方法包括聚类、分类和回归分析。
数据建模流程:
- 数据预处理: 对数据进行特征提取和降维处理。
- 模型训练: 使用监督学习或无监督学习算法训练模型。
- 模型评估: 通过交叉验证和指标评估模型性能。
- 模型部署: 将训练好的模型部署到生产环境中,实时处理数据。
3. 数据可视化与交互
数栈灵瞳提供了丰富的可视化组件,包括图表、地图、仪表盘和3D模型。用户可以通过拖放方式快速构建可视化界面,并支持交互式操作。
可视化组件:
- 图表: 支持柱状图、折线图、饼图等多种图表类型。
- 地图: 提供交互式地图,支持数据标注和地理围栏功能。
- 仪表盘: 用户可以自定义仪表盘,实时监控数据变化。
- 3D模型: 通过3D技术实现复杂的数据展示,如数字孪生场景。
数栈灵瞳技术实现
数栈灵瞳的技术实现基于分布式计算框架、大数据处理技术和可视化引擎。以下是其实现的关键技术点:
1. 分布式计算框架
数栈灵瞳采用分布式计算框架(如Spark、Flink)处理大规模数据。分布式架构能够提高计算效率,同时支持高并发和高吞吐量。
分布式计算的优势:
- 高扩展性: 支持弹性扩展,适应数据量的增长。
- 高可用性: 通过节点冗余和故障恢复机制保证系统的稳定性。
- 高效性: 分布式计算能够并行处理数据,显著提高处理速度。
2. 大数据处理技术
数栈灵瞳支持多种大数据处理技术,包括数据清洗、转换、聚合和分析。常见的处理工具包括Hadoop、Spark和Flink。
大数据处理流程:
- 数据清洗: 去除无效数据和重复数据。
- 数据转换: 将数据转换为适合分析的格式。
- 数据聚合: 对数据进行分组和汇总,提取关键指标。
- 数据分析: 使用统计分析和机器学习算法对数据进行深度分析。
3. 可视化引擎
数栈灵瞳的可视化引擎基于WebGL和Three.js技术,支持3D可视化和交互式操作。可视化引擎能够渲染高质量的图形,并支持大规模数据的实时更新。
可视化引擎的特点:
- 高性能渲染: 使用硬件加速技术提高渲染效率。
- 交互式操作: 支持缩放、旋转和筛选等交互操作。
- 动态更新: 实时更新数据,保持可视化界面的动态性。
数栈灵瞳技术优化
为了提高数栈灵瞳的性能和用户体验,需要从多个方面进行优化。以下是优化的关键点:
1. 性能优化
性能优化是数栈灵瞳技术优化的核心。通过优化数据处理和可视化渲染性能,可以显著提高系统的响应速度。
性能优化方法:
- 数据压缩: 使用压缩算法减少数据传输和存储的开销。
- 缓存机制: 使用缓存技术减少重复计算和数据查询。
- 并行计算: 利用多核处理器和分布式计算框架提高计算效率。
2. 可扩展性优化
随着数据量的增加,数栈灵瞳需要具备良好的可扩展性,以适应数据规模的增长。
可扩展性优化方法:
- 弹性扩展: 根据数据量动态调整计算资源。
- 负载均衡: 使用负载均衡技术分配计算任务,避免单点过载。
- 分布式存储: 使用分布式存储系统(如HDFS)存储大规模数据。
3. 用户体验优化
用户体验是数栈灵瞳成功的关键。通过优化界面设计和交互体验,可以提高用户的使用效率和满意度。
用户体验优化方法:
- 响应式设计: 适配不同设备的屏幕尺寸,提供一致的用户体验。
- 交互反馈: 提供实时的交互反馈,增强用户的操作感。
- 数据驱动的交互: 根据用户行为调整可视化界面,提供个性化的体验。
4. 安全性优化
数据安全是企业关注的重要问题。数栈灵瞳需要具备完善的安全机制,保护数据的机密性和完整性。
安全性优化方法:
- 数据加密: 对敏感数据进行加密处理,防止数据泄露。
- 访问控制: 实施严格的访问控制策略,限制未经授权的访问。
- 审计日志: 记录用户的操作日志,便于安全审计和追溯。
数栈灵瞳的应用场景
数栈灵瞳广泛应用于多个行业,包括智慧城市、工业互联网、金融和零售。以下是几个典型的应用场景:
1. 智慧城市
在智慧城市中,数栈灵瞳可以用于实时监控城市交通、环境质量和公共安全。通过数字孪生技术,城市管理者可以模拟城市运行状态,优化资源配置。
应用场景:
- 交通管理: 实时监控交通流量,预测交通拥堵。
- 环境监测: 监测空气质量、水质和噪声污染。
- 公共安全: 监控城市摄像头,及时发现异常事件。
2. 工业互联网
在工业互联网中,数栈灵瞳可以用于设备状态监测、生产过程优化和预测性维护。通过工业数字孪生技术,企业可以实现智能化生产。
应用场景:
- 设备监测: 监测设备运行状态,预测设备故障。
- 生产优化: 优化生产流程,提高生产效率。
- 预测性维护: 根据设备历史数据,预测维护时间。
3. 金融
在金融领域,数栈灵瞳可以用于风险评估、交易监控和客户画像。通过大数据分析和可视化技术,金融机构可以更好地管理风险和客户关系。
应用场景:
- 风险评估: 评估客户的信用风险和市场风险。
- 交易监控: 监控交易行为,发现异常交易。
- 客户画像: 绘制客户画像,精准营销。
4. 零售
在零售领域,数栈灵瞳可以用于销售分析、库存管理和客户行为分析。通过数据可视化技术,零售企业可以更好地了解市场需求和客户行为。
应用场景:
- 销售分析: 分析销售数据,发现销售趋势。
- 库存管理: 监控库存状态,优化库存管理。
- 客户行为分析: 分析客户行为,制定精准营销策略。
数栈灵瞳是一款功能强大且易于使用的数据可视化平台,能够帮助企业从数据中提取价值,并通过直观的可视化方式呈现。如果您对数栈灵瞳感兴趣,可以申请试用,体验其强大的功能和优化效果。
申请试用&https://www.dtstack.com/?src=bbs
通过本文的介绍,您对数栈灵瞳的技术实现与优化有了更深入的了解。如果您有任何问题或需要进一步的帮助,请随时联系我们。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。